What you hate most about your Toyota

Figured this would get some good reactions.

What I hate most about my Yota, the friggin stupid cup holders. I have the little drawer type that pulls out of the dash above the HVAC controls.

First, the holes are too small to hold drinks that are sold in stores today.

Second, it blocks your HVAC controls and drips condensation all over the dash and radio.

third, it blocks the HVAC vent, which is a two fold problem. If I have a cold drink in the morning, my heater heats the drink up and it blocks cool air on hot days.
